Vanilla Chocolate Panna Cotta with Mango Coulis(Gelatin Free)

After a visit to an Italian Restaurant I was so impressed with desserts and want to try it.Finally I got to make Panna Cotta. Panna Cotta is purely originated from Piedmont,Italy! It is termed as "Cooked Cream" as an Italian dessert!


I used an Agar Agar as replaced by gelatin and it tasted lovely.It is so simple and tasted heavenly. It can be served along with berries or caramel sauce or chocolate sauce or fruit coulis

Here I made Mango Vanilla and chocolate panna cotta with mango coulis

Ingredients:

Panna Cotta


  • 1 1/2 Cup Heavy Whipping cream
  • 1 Cup Milk
  • 1/4 cup Sugar
  • Agar Agar( If you have Agar Agar powder use 1 Tsp otherwise take out the thin membranes of agar agar atleast 2 Tablespoons break into pieces.)
  • 2 Tsp Vanilla Extract
  • 1 cup Water for Agar Agar thin membranes.
  • 1/4 cup semi sweet chocolate bars
Mango Coulis

  • 1 cup Mango puree from 1 Mango. (Add Cardamom powder if you want while making puree)
  • 1/4 cup Powdered sugar
Garnish:

  • Mango Puree 
  • Mint leaves

Method:



  1. Combine all the ingredients together such as Milk,Cream and mix well.Soak 1 Tablespoon of agar agar into the water for about 15 to 20 minutes.
  2. Add soaked agar agar into the milk cream mixture and let it dissolve it for about 10 to 15 minutes on medium low heat.
  3. Mix well and add sugar.
  4. Once Agar agar is dissolved,Add vanilla extract.
  5. Divide the mixture into 2 halves.Add semi sweet melted chocolate bars into the milk cream mixture.
  6. Transfer it into 2 bowls after sieved it.
  7. Pour evenly into the ramekins ( I had made 2 Vanilla and  2 chocolate) as seen in the picture.If you like to add both flavors ,add chocolate panna cotta and pour white panna cotta carefully on the chocolate panna cotta and Keep it in the fridge for about 1 hour or until it is set.
  8. Put the mango pieces into the mixie along with cardamom powder(optional) and blend it into puree.
  9. On medium heat,Pour the mango puree along with sugar into the medium saucepan and allow it to stir 
  10. Take the remaining agar agar and add the remaining 1/2 cup water and let it boil on medium heat.Once it is dissolved.
  11. Pour the hot agar mixture to the hot mango puree sugar mixture and keep stirring.that is called mango coulis.
  12. Once it gets thickened while stirring continuously.
  13. Pour the thickened mango puree mixture on the top of the panna cotta evenly.
  14. Make sure it gets back to the fridge and allow it to set for about 1 hour or until it is set.
  15. Place the ramekins on warm water to release the panna cotta before invert it on the serving plate.
  16. Invert the ramekins into the serving plate.
  17. Garnish it with mango puree agar mixture as you like.
  18. Serve immediately when chilled.
